Findings


The observations revealed a diverse range of tasks, highlighting the multifaceted nature of residential plumbing. Common tasks included:


Leak Detection and Repair: This was a frequent service call, ranging from minor drips to significant water damage. John and Mary employed a variety of techniques to locate leaks, including visual inspection, pressure testing, and the use of moisture meters. Repair methods varied depending on the type of pipe and the location of the leak, but often involved cutting and replacing sections of pipe, soldering copper pipes, or using compression fittings.
Drain Cleaning: Clogged drains were another common problem. John and Mary used a variety of tools to clear blockages, including plungers, drain snakes (both manual and motorized), and hydro-jetting equipment. The type of tool used depended on the severity and location of the clog.
Fixture Installation and Repair: This included installing and repairing faucets, toilets, showers, and sinks. These tasks required a combination of plumbing skills and carpentry knowledge, as well as an understanding of building codes.
Water Heater Maintenance and Replacement: Water heaters are a critical component of residential plumbing systems. John and Mary performed routine maintenance on water heaters, such as flushing sediment and checking the anode rod. They also replaced old or malfunctioning water heaters, ensuring proper installation and compliance with safety regulations.
Troubleshooting and Diagnosis: A significant portion of their time was spent troubleshooting complex plumbing problems. This required a deep understanding of plumbing systems and the ability to diagnose problems based on limited information. They often used a process of elimination, testing different components to isolate the source of the problem.


Problem-Solving Strategies


The study revealed several key problem-solving strategies employed by the plumbers:


Visual Inspection: The first step in most cases was a thorough visual inspection of the plumbing system. This involved looking for signs of leaks, corrosion, or other damage.
Listening and Observation: Plumbers often relied on their senses to diagnose problems. They listened for the sound of running water, felt for temperature changes, and observed water pressure.
Testing and Measurement: They used a variety of tools to test and measure different aspects of the plumbing system, such as water pressure, flow rate, and temperature.
Knowledge of Building Codes: A thorough understanding of local building codes was essential for ensuring that all work was performed safely and in compliance with regulations.
Experience and Intuition: Years of experience allowed them to develop a strong intuition for plumbing problems. They often relied on their gut feeling to guide their diagnosis and repair efforts.

Challenges


The plumbers faced a number of challenges in their daily work:


Difficult Access: Plumbing systems are often located in cramped or difficult-to-reach areas, such as under sinks, behind walls, or in crawl spaces.
Unexpected Problems: Plumbing problems can be unpredictable and complex. They often encountered unexpected issues that required creative solutions.
Dealing with Unhappy Clients: Clients were often stressed or frustrated when they experienced plumbing problems. The plumbers had to be able to handle these situations with patience and empathy.
Physical Demands: Plumbing work can be physically demanding, requiring lifting heavy objects, working in awkward positions, and exposure to dirt and grime.

  • Staying Up-to-Date: The plumbing industry is constantly evolving, with new technologies and materials being introduced regularly. Plumbers had to stay up-to-date on these changes through continuing education and training.
